Master's programs in environmental science are graduate-level academic programs focused on the study of the environment, ecosystems, and natural resources, with an emphasis on sustainability, conservation, and management.
Key Features
- Interdisciplinary coursework
- Fieldwork opportunities
- Research projects
- Specialization options
- Career preparation
Pros
- Opportunity to gain advanced knowledge and skills in environmental science
- Potential for career advancement in various fields such as conservation, resource management, and policy making
- Networking with professionals in the environmental science industry
Cons
- Intensive coursework and research requirements may be challenging for some students
- Limited job prospects in certain geographic regions
